Abstract
PURPOSE:To manufacture a highly efficient heat exchanger at small man-hours by winding a specified quantity of tube directly around a main tube, and forming an optimum passage by making reversing of the main tube and returning of a tube guide synchronously. CONSTITUTION:When a driving source 19 is operated, a main tube 1 rotates clockwise and a guide roller attached to a tube guide 20 moves synchronously, and plural tubes to be worked are wound around the main tube 1 simultaneously. When the driving device 19 is stopped after winding a specified quantity, the main tube 1 and guide roller 11 come to a stop and a directly wound spiral tube is manufactured. When the driving device 19 is reversed next, the main tube 1 rotates counterclockwise and the guide roller also returns to the opposite direction synchronously. The diameter of winding is adjusted according to the amount of reverse rotation. A fixing plate is inserted and fixed to the main tube 1 in the finishing side of winding of the spiral tube to complete winding.
